"Excepional Care for My Husband"

About: Glenrothes Hospital / Rehabilitation & Recovery Scottish Ambulance Service / Emergency Ambulance Victoria Hospital / Medicine of the Elderly

(as a carer),

My husband was dealt with by three fantastic paramedics who virtually saved his life (Nikki, Ang & Rachel). They admitted him to Ward 41 at Victoria Hospital where he was cared for for approximately six weeks and the care and support he and my family were given was superb.

He was then transferred to Ward 2 at Glenrothes Hospital (under the care of Senior Charge Nurse Lorraine) where his condition was managed for a further 11 weeks. Again, the loving care and understanding could not be faulted in any way. All the staff (Medical and Domestic) were just magnificent.

These people are simply Angels and deserve every praise possible.
